From e59ff2c49ae16e1d179de679aca81405829aee6c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jason Wang Date: Thu, 22 Nov 2018 14:36:30 +0800 Subject: virtio-net: disable guest csum during XDP set We don't disable VIRTIO_NET_F_GUEST_CSUM if XDP was set. This means we can receive partial csumed packets with metadata kept in the vnet_hdr. This may have several side effects: - It could be overridden by header adjustment, thus is might be not correct after XDP processing. - There's no way to pass such metadata information through XDP_REDIRECT to another driver. - XDP does not support checksum offload right now. So simply disable guest csum if possible in this the case of XDP.
